DES MOINES, Iowa — After nearly 115 years, the historic Des Moines City Hall building is now closed. A city spokesperson said the move of city services at the Historic City Hall to the former Nationwide building, now called the T.M. Franklin Cownie City Administration Building, at 1200 Locust Street, is complete. More city services, […]
